Handover Note — Marek to Ilsa

Sales leads: read this before Monday. The Kestrel Division hiring freeze stands until further notice. No new reqs, no backfills without my sign-off transferring to Ilsa. Contractors already onboarded stay; renewals need Ilsa's approval. Pipeline targets are unchanged — cover gaps with the Torvale overlay team. Two offers already extended will be honoured; nothing else goes out. Exit interviews route to HR as usual. Ilsa takes full ownership Thursday. There is one matter you should hold close.

internal memo for kaduf-baduf: Only 35 of the 378 pilot accounts renewed Holir, so a churn review is set for June 11. Eliielax Group is in early talks to buy Silaelix Group for about $142.1 million.

Subject: DR drill Thursday — webhook retries

Hey, quick heads-up before Thursday's drill. We're failing over Hopwire's webhook dispatcher to the Bramfield standby cluster, so expect retry storms: exponential backoff starts at 5s, caps at 10 minutes, max eight attempts, then dead-letter. Duplicate deliveries are possible — consumers should already dedupe on event ID, but keep an eye on the Parcelgram integration since it's flaky about that. If the standby vault locks you out mid-drill, don't page anyone; just use the recovery passphrase below.

vault phrase of kafog-kahif = holdor-rusir-praox

Turnstile counts from the Bramblewick Stadium gates flowing in weird? Usually it's the Gatetally collector choking on out-of-order pulses after a network blip. Bounce the collector pod first — counts self-heal from the gate-side buffer, so you won't lose anything. If totals still drift from the steward headcount by more than 2%, flip on replay mode and let it chew through the buffer overnight. Page Dovan only if replay stalls. Log the incident against the running build, token below.

trace token, kahog-tajeg: htk6_97d963

Step 4 — Wiring up StormFunnel. Once the fan-out workers are registered, the alert broker (Gustline) won't accept your batch pushes until the deploy artifact is signed. Don't skip this — we learned that the hard way during the Harwick hailstorm drill. Grab the staging config, bump the version, and sign before pushing. Paste the deploy key directly under the line that follows this one.

signing key of baduf-taweg = bky6_Zf7bem